Airbags

Reports naming the air-bag system — deployment behaviour, inflators, sensors and warning lights.

20
reports

From owner reports, verbatim

VEHICLE HIT A CURB ON THE RIGHT FRONT TIRE AT APPROXIMATELY 5 MPH AND BOTH FRONTAL AIR BAGS DEPLOYED. NO INJURY REPORTED. ALSO, NO DAMAGE TO THE VEHICLE, EXCEPT THE RIGHT FRONT TIRE. VEHICLE WAS TOWED TO THE REPAIR SHOP, AND MECHANIC CONFIRMED THAT THE VEHICLE DID NOT SUSTAIN ANY DAMAGES, AND THE RIGHT FRONT TIRE NEEDED TO BE REPLACED. THE DEALER WAS NOT NOTIFIED.*AK

NHTSA ID 10115334 · filed Mar 17, 2005

WHILE DRIVING BOTH SIDE AIRBAGS DEPLOYED WITHOUT ANY WARNING, CAUSING INJURIES. DEALER HAS BEEN NOTIFIED. *AK

NHTSA ID 8018752 · filed Sep 16, 2002

Suspension

Reports naming suspension components — springs, struts, shocks, control arms and related hardware.

2
reports

From owner reports, verbatim

AT 53743 MILES RIGHT WHEEL BEARING WENT, FIXED BY DEALER. I NOTICED THE SAME NOISE AGAIN AT 78378, ONLY 24,635 LATER THE RIGHT REAR WHEEL BEARING NEEDED TO BE REPLACED AGAIN. I CALLED SUBARU AND THEY TOLD ME IT WAS A WEAR ITEM. THIS SHOULD NOT HAVE HAPPENED TWICE AND FEEL THIS IS A SAFETY ISSUE, I COULD HAVE LOST CONTROL OF VEHICLE.

NHTSA ID 10039432 · filed Sep 24, 2003

RIGHT REAR WHEEL BEARING WENT AT 53,743 MILES ON MY 1995 SUBARU IMPREZA. SUBARU HAD A TSB AND USED LEGACY BEARINGS FOR THE FIX. IF NOT FIXED TIRE CAN SEPARATE FROM CAR AND LOSE CONTROL.

NHTSA ID 10039431 · filed Sep 24, 2003
